A ton of potential first-round picks playing today:

Lonzo Ball
De'Aaron Fox
Malik Monk
Justin Jackson
Bam Adebayo
T.J. Leaf
Johnathan Motley
Ike Anigbogu (2018)
Tony Bradley (2018)
Sindarius Thornwell

Also a few second-round prospects:

Devin Robinson
Nigel Hayes
Kelan Martin
Kennedy Meeks
Ethan Happ (2018)
Theo Pinson (2018)

Am I missing anyone? What a loaded day for draft prospects and college basketball itself.

I'm thinking the Jazz will let Hill go past a certain price and a certain number of years (like 3 rich years), but it's hard to say what that will be. Letting Hill walk might be a blessing in disguise if it gives the Jazz more flexibility to experiment with deals involving Favors, Lyles, Burks and possibly even Hood.

I'm thinking Hayward stays with the Jazz because Gobert is emerging as a franchise player and could continue to improve for another year or two. So staying in Utah is the best combination of getting paid, winning games and being featured as a primary player.

Then the Jazz will ask themselves where they're going to get an impact guard in the backcourt and a versatile, stretchy PF. They've been good at finding bench players that work in Quin's system.
